Title : The Mediator complex kinase module is necessary for fructose regulation of liver glycogen levels through induction of glucose-6-phosphatase catalytic subunit (G6pc).

3 However, feeding in the presence of fructose in water suppressed glycogen accumulation in the liver by up-regulating the expression of glucose-6-phosphatase catalytic subunit (G6pc) gene although the exact mechanism is unknown. Glycogen glucose-6-phosphatase, catalytic Mus musculus

5 CONCLUSIONS: Taken together, our data suggest that the kinase module of the Mediator complex is necessary for the transcriptional activation of metabolic genes, such as G6pc, and has an important role in regulation of the glycogen levels in the liver through altering transcription factor binding and activity at the G6pc promoter.
